A mobile service is comprised of one or more units (technologist and equipment) that provide nuclear medicine, nuclear cardiology or PET imaging services at one or more locations and meet the following criteria, without exception:

  1. All examinations that are performed at the mobile locations must be interpreted by physicians included in the application for accreditation.

  2. All technologists performing any examinations at the mobile locations must be included in the application for accreditation.

  3. The entire mobile service must share the same Medical Director and Technical Director.

  4. All physicians and technologists must participate together in quality assurance and education programs, including in-house conferences.

  5. The entire mobile service must utilize identical protocols.

ADDING A MOBILE SITE OR MOBILE SERVICE

Laboratories wanting to add a mobile site and/or mobile service to an application that has already been granted accreditation must:

  1. Complete the Multiple site/Mobile service Supplement

  2. Provide an updated equipment list using the appropriate section of the New/Addition Staff and Instrumentation Form. They are not required to submit the "Add On Site" Audit.  If any physicians and/or technologists have been hired since accreditation was granted, it will be necessary to submit the appropriate forms and supporting documentation for these staff members as well.

If the added mobile site or mobile service is accepted into the laboratory's accreditation, accreditation for the added multiple site or mobile service will expire when the laboratory's original accreditation expires.

THINGS TO KNOW IF YOU ARE A MOBILE SERVICE LABORATORY

If eligible, applicants with a mobile service may apply with a single application and will be assessed a $200 mobile application fee. Additional fees for mobile services may be assessed based upon size, complexity and geographic distribution.


If accreditation is granted, it will be granted to the mobile service collectively, and not to each location individually (although the name and address of each location will be entered into the ICANL database).


Applicants with mobile services that are granted accreditation will receive one certificate, listing the institution name as listed in the accreditation agreement, for each testing area.


All ICANL correspondence will go through the institution listed on the accreditation agreement.
